Pascale Bouchier is a scholar working on Epidemiology, Infectious Diseases and Immunology. According to data from OpenAlex, Pascale Bouchier has authored 6 papers receiving a total of 403 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 3 papers in Epidemiology, 3 papers in Infectious Diseases and 2 papers in Immunology. Recurrent topics in Pascale Bouchier’s work include Malaria Research and Control (1 paper), Pneumonia and Respiratory Infections (1 paper) and T-cell and B-cell Immunology (1 paper). Pascale Bouchier is often cited by papers focused on Malaria Research and Control (1 paper), Pneumonia and Respiratory Infections (1 paper) and T-cell and B-cell Immunology (1 paper). Pascale Bouchier collaborates with scholars based in The Netherlands, United States and United Kingdom. Pascale Bouchier's co-authors include Johannes P. M. Langedijk, Daphné Truan, Myra N. Widjojoatmodjo, Jason S. McLellan, Hanneke Schuitemaker, Roland Zahn, Anders Krarup, Lies Bogaert, Tina Ritschel and Mark J. G. Bakkers and has published in prestigious journals such as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ences, Nature Communications and Blood.
